    Plastic Man (Patrick "Eel" O'Brian) is a superhero first appearing in Police Comics #1, originally published by Quality Comics and later acquired by DC Comics, appearing in their American comic books. Created by cartoonist Jack Cole, Plastic Man was one of the first superheroes to incorporate humor into mainstream action storytelling.This character has been published in several solo series and ...

Dec 27, 2018 · Back in 1979, when DC's Super Friends was smashing television ratings for ABC, the network released The Plastic Man Comedy/Adventure Show to air directly after Super Friends.The show was an amazing success and ran until 1981. The series was broken into separate vignettes all related to the hero.
